I run 205/40/17 just to keep it close to the same measurements as standars wheels. Wont wffect your speedo etc then. You have to bear in mind jf you run massive wheels with big tyres then tje gearing is effectivley changed. Mpg wont be accurate nor will your speed on the speedo.

ha, for a sec there i thought the car was lowered, will look cool, wagons are very very rare over here.

well if the tyres are good then i wouldnt waste my money buying new ones, but when time comes ild go 215/45/17 as to still give you nice grip, good sidewall for comfort and is usually the cheapest tyre as it is the standard size for 17" :thumbsup:
